LumiAdd’s Latest Luminaire ‘Lacrimosa Pro’ Honoured at Mix Awards 2025

LumiAdd is proud to announce that its newest luminaire, the Lacrimosa Pro, has been honoured as Product of the Year – Lighting at the prestigious Mix Awards 2025. The accolade follows a rigorous judging process by an expert panel of commercial interiors professionals, recognising the product for its sustainable innovation, manufacturing excellence and design integrity.
The Lacrimosa Pro is a sculptural pendant luminaire inspired by an asymmetric ‘twisted’ teardrop form, with its light source discreetly nestled within. Daringly utilising a fully nonplanar 3Dprinting process – where the print head moves continuously across three axes – meaning the end product achieves a seamless, fluid form that defies typical layer-based constraints. Made from renewable, plant-based polymers optionally enhanced with repurposed waste materials, Lacrimosa Pro is available in over 180 curated colourways and finishes – offering an exceptional breadth of aesthetic choice without compromising on sustainability.
Judges praised the Lacrimosa Pro as “exceptionally strong”, highlighting its zero-waste manufacturing, local UK production and measured circularity performance. The product’s innovative buyback scheme, supporting refurbishment and recycling, was emphasised as integral to its lifecycle strategy. Special commendation was given for transparent CO₂ equivalent savings compared with fossil-based plastics and aluminium.
Functionality has not been compromised for form. With selectable optics (a 340° glow or a narrow beam yielding up to 121 luminaire lumens per circuit watt), the Lacrimosa Pro is equally suited to decorative and task focused applications. Its low glare design and range of curated sizes ensure versatility across hospitality, workplace, and residential projects.
